Fireworks Display
Thursday, July 3 | 9 p.m. | Oyster Factory & Wright Family Parks
The 20-minute fireworks show will be launched from a barge in the May River and can be
viewed from both parks.
Note: Barge positioning is subject to change due to multiple variables; attendees may need
to adjust their seating location for the best view.

Dock Closures:
For public safety and to prevent overcrowding and weight restrictions on docks, both the
Calhoun Street Regional Dock and the Oyster Factory Dock will be closed to pedestrians
from 5-11 p.m. on July 3. Boat access remains open.
